CVBL: Memphis 87, Utah 86

Memphis beat Utah today in a 87-86 game that was close the whole way. For much of the game, it looked like Utah would be able to pull off the win, thanks in large part to an outstanding performance by Feaster. But the tide finally turned in the end, with Memphis star Hayes leading his team to victory.

"Definitely a great game," said Memphis coach Bob after the game. "The fans got their money's worth out of it, and both teams put up a good fight. We're just glad that we were able to finish strong and get the W. Hayes was a big part of that, and I don't think we'd have won without his efforts."

Memphis was led by Hayes (20 points, 4 blocks), Jensen (14 points, 5 boards, 1 assists, 2 steals, 2 blocks), Dolly (22 points, 0 assists). Utah was led by Feaster (20 points, 19 boards, 1 assists, a block), Patton (16 points, 2 blocks), Smiley (10 points, 6 boards, 1 assists, 2 blocks).

After today's win, Memphis improve to 29-14. They hold at #1 in the Southwest and remain at #3 overall in the Western Conference. Utah have lost their last 5 games and stand at 24-21 and 12-10 at home. They hold at #3 in the Northwest and stay at #7 overall in the Western Conference.
